php eventloop features and specs

  • Simple and lightweight
    The library provides a minimalistic implementation of an event loop in PHP, making it easy to understand and integrate into small projects without heavy dependencies.
  • Educational value
    As a straightforward PHP event loop implementation, it serves as a great learning resource for developers wanting to understand how event loops and asynchronous programming concepts work under the hood in PHP.
  • Non-blocking I/O support
    The library enables non-blocking I/O operations in PHP, allowing developers to handle multiple tasks concurrently without relying on multi-threading, which PHP does not natively support well.
  • Timer and periodic task support
    It provides built-in support for timers and periodic tasks, enabling developers to schedule recurring operations or delayed execution within the event loop.
  • Pure PHP implementation
    The library is written in pure PHP without requiring external C extensions, making it portable and easy to install across different PHP environments without special compilation steps.

Possible disadvantages of php eventloop

  • Limited community and support
    The project has a very small community with minimal stars, forks, and contributors on GitHub, which means limited peer support, fewer bug reports, and potentially slower issue resolution.
  • Not production-ready
    Given its small scale and limited adoption, the library may not be battle-tested enough for production environments where reliability, performance, and stability are critical.
  • Limited features compared to alternatives
    More established PHP async libraries like ReactPHP, AmpPHP, and others offer far more comprehensive ecosystems with HTTP servers, database clients, and stream handling that this library lacks.
  • Performance limitations
    Being a pure PHP implementation without leveraging extensions like ev, libuv, or swoole, the event loop may suffer from performance bottlenecks compared to extension-backed alternatives when handling high concurrency.
  • Poor documentation
    The repository has minimal documentation and examples, making it difficult for new users to understand the full API, edge cases, and best practices for using the library effectively.

Analysis of php eventloop

Overall verdict

  • php-eventloop is a lightweight event loop implementation for PHP that provides a solid, minimalistic solution for developers wanting to implement asynchronous, non-blocking behavior without adopting a full framework like ReactPHP or Amp. It's good for learning purposes and simpler use cases, though it lacks the extensive ecosystem, tooling, and production hardening of more established async libraries.
